Summary
The Baltimore Ravens traded two future first-round draft picks to the Las Vegas Raiders to acquire pass rusher Maxx Crosby. Crosby shared his excitement about joining the Ravens through a message on Instagram.
Key Facts
- The Ravens traded two first-round picks, in 2026 and 2027, to get Maxx Crosby from the Raiders.
- Crosby played seven seasons with the Raiders and made the playoffs once.
- He has been named to the Pro Bowl the last five seasons.
- In the 2025 season, Crosby recorded 10 sacks in 15 games.
- Crosby posted a message on Instagram saying, "RAVENS FLOCK… ITS TIME," to show his excitement about joining the team.
- Crosby was initially drafted by the Raiders in the fourth round of the 2019 NFL Draft.
- He shared a farewell video thanking the Raiders for his time there.
- Crosby stated he is ready to give his all to the Ravens and be a strong leader.
